China (PRC) Senior High School Graduation Diploma

Admission review process

Applicants will be considered for admission on their senior high school transcript (Grades 1, 2 and midyear grade 3) and all available results of the Huikao exams. Huikao/APT results must be in numeric or letter grade format (see next line).

If your HUIKAO results are presented as ‘qualified/unqualified’ (or ‘pass/fail’), or if you are in a province where the Huikao or APT is not offered, then additional external testing results are expected for the evaluation of your application. We prefer to see ACT or SAT, or final AP examination results (See U.S. High School Applicants). However, if you are not taking ACT/SAT, or have not yet taken any AP examinations, please provide other results you may have such as results for school-based graduation examinations or, if these are not available, then your rank within your grade level and school. Applicants who are not able to provide any of this information are still eligible to apply and will be considered on a case-by-case basis.

If admitted, you are expected to maintain your level of academic performance through to the completion of your pre-McGill studies.

If admitted to McGill, you must arrange for your school to send to McGill University an official final transcript of your complete high school record, the graduation certificate, and all final HUIKAO results.

If you write the GAOKAO, you must make arrangements to forward to us the final official results.


Minimum grades and prerequisites

The minimum requirements are normally averages of 85% or higher in each year and in all prerequisite courses. Many programs are more competitive and will require higher grades; applicants who present the minimum requirements are not guaranteed admission.

Bachelor of Arts and Science (B.A. &Sc.)

PREREQUISITES
  • Subjects must include mathematics and two science courses in biology, chemistry, or physics through Senior high school
  • Huikao exams


Note: The B.A. & Sc. is a unique degree that is jointly offered by the Faculty of Arts and the Faculty of Science.  It is rooted in both Arts and Science and carries roughly equal course weight in each faculty. It is an interdisciplinary degree intended for students who want to pursue simultaneously a Major in the Faculty of Arts and one in the Faculty of Science or one of the interfaculty programs in Cognitive Science, Environment or Sustainability, Science and Society.
